DOT1L inhibition exerts anti-tumor effects by activating interferon signaling in breast cancer cells
2025-08-06
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>Background DOT1L, a histone H3 lysine 79 (H3K79) methyltransferase, is a potential therapeutic target in various malignancies. In the present study, we aimed to clarify the antitumor effect of DOT1L inhibition in breast cancer. Methods Estrogen receptor (ER)-positive/HER2-negative breast cancer cells (MCF7) and ER-negative/HER2-positive cells (SKBR3) were treated with a DOT1L inhibitor...
